NBC Universal Talks DreamWorks Purchase

NBC Universal is in talks to buy DreamWorks SKG, in what could be a deal worth $1 billion, according to the trades. Universal Studios already distributes DreamWorks' videos and DVDs via Universal Studios Home Video, and its films internationally through United Pictures International, the foreign distributor jointly owned by Universal and Paramount. Additionally, the two studios have co-financed films such as the 2000 Oscar-winner GLADIATOR and Steven Spielberg's upcoming MUNICH, which Universal will release in December. Spielberg began his directing and producing career 35 years ago at Universal.

Early rumors are that if the deal went through Universal would distribute DreamWorks produced films, making it similar to the deal Brian Grazer and Ron Howard’s Imagine Ent. has with the studio. It is also unknown what roles DreamWorks' three founders — Spielberg, Jeffrey Katzenberg and David Geffen — would continue to play after an acquisition.

Spielberg has always said he is not interested in a top post at a publicly traded company. Since Katzenberg has taken the mantle of ceo at DreamWorks Animation, he removed himself from the dealings of the live-action unit. DreamWorks Animation, as a publicly traded company of its own, is not part of the acquisition discussions. Geffen on the other hand is the truly unknown with some saying he’d ask to be put on the NBC Universal board and others saying he’d take a buyout deal.

Since its inception in 1994, the DreamWorks journey has been a rollercoaster. It won Oscars and financial success with films like AMERICAN BEAUTY, GLADIATOR and SHREK, however produced flops like SINBAD: LEGEND OF THE SEVEN SEAS and the most recent disappointment, THE ISLAND.

It has been rumored that the studio on two occasions has been close to bankruptcy.

NBC Universal is one of the world's leading media and entertainment companies in the development, production and marketing of entertainment, news and information to a global audience. Formed in May 2004 through the combining of NBC and Vivendi Universal Ent., NBC Universal owns and operates the No. 1 television network, the fastest-growing Spanish-language network, a valuable portfolio of news and entertainment networks, a premier motion picture company, significant television production operations, a leading television stations group and world-renowned theme parks. NBC Universal is 80%-owned by General Electric, with 20% controlled by Vivendi Universal.
